<?php header('content-type:text/html; charset=utf-8'); /* 要做:商城的留言板一般情况,做留言板的显示很容易 直接select 查询,再显示出来但ecshop中的留言板难点在于 留言数据来自于2张表 feedback 留言表 comment 评论表我们需要把2张表中的数据取出来,显示. 思路:从业务逻辑层,用php来解决这个问题 1:先
测试数据CREATE TABLE dept( /*部门表*/ deptno MEDIUMINT UNSIGNED NOT NULL DEFAULT 0, dname VARCHAR(20) NOT NULL DEFAULT "", loc VARCHAR(13) NOT NULL DEFAULT "" ); INSERT INTO dept VALUES(10, 'ACCOUNTI
转载 2023-09-30 09:45:55
92阅读
## MySQL UNION ALL与分页的实现 在使用 MySQL 数据库进行查询时,可能会涉及到多个表的数据整合。我们可以使用 `UNION ALL` 实现将多个查询的结果合并在一起。虽然 `UNION ALL` 主要用于组合结果集,但如果我们希望在合并结果的基础上进行分页,同样可以实现。接下来,我们将通过几个步骤来了解如何在 `UNION ALL` 的结果上进行分页。 ### 流程概览
原创 10月前
510阅读
# MySQL Union 分页实现指南 ## 引言 在开发中,我们经常会遇到需要将多个结果集合并后进行分页展示的需求。MySQL提供了`UNION`操作符来实现这一功能。本文将向您介绍如何使用`UNION`和其他相关技术实现MySQL分页。 ## 流程 下面是实现MySQL Union分页的一般流程: | 步骤 | 描述 | | --- | --- | | 步骤一 | 计算总记录数 | |
原创 2023-08-24 22:13:18
498阅读
# MySQL UNION 分页排序指南 当我们使用 MySQL 数据库并需要结合多个表的数据时,常常会用到 `UNION`。此外,为了优化用户体验,我们通常需要对结果进行分页和排序。本文将会详细介绍如何实现 MySQL UNION 分页排序,并提供一个清晰的步骤指南。 ## 流程概述 在实现 Union 分页排序之前,我们首先需要明确每个步骤。以下是整个流程的步骤总结: | 步骤 | 描
原创 2024-10-04 06:05:54
84阅读
# Mysql Union分页实现 ## 概述 在处理大量数据时,我们经常会使用 UNION 连接多个查询结果,但是当我们需要对 UNION 后的结果进行分页展示时,就需要一些特殊的处理。本文将介绍如何使用 Mysql 实现 UNION 后的分页功能。 ## 流程图 下面是实现 "Mysql Union分页" 的流程图: ```mermaid erDiagram Develope
原创 2023-08-25 10:39:05
778阅读
select * from table LIMIT 5,10; #返回第6-15行数据   select * from table LIMIT 5; #返回前5行   select * from&nb
# MySQL Union 分页效率实现方法 ## 引言 在进行数据库查询时,有时可能需要将多个查询的结果联合在一起,这时可以使用 MySQLUNION 操作符。然而,当数据量较大时,直接使用 UNION 可能会导致效率低下,特别是在分页查询时。本文将介绍如何实现 MySQL UNION 分页效率的优化方法,并提供详细的代码示例和注释。 ## 整体流程 首先,让我们来看一下整个实现过
原创 2023-08-11 19:18:26
225阅读
# MySQL UNION分页MySQL数据库中,我们经常会用到`UNION`操作符来合并多个查询的结果集。但是当需要对合并后的结果进行分页操作时,可能会遇到一些困难。本文将介绍如何在MySQL中使用`UNION`操作符再分页,并给出相应的代码示例。 ## 什么是`UNION`操作符 `UNION`操作符用于合并两个或多个SELECT语句的结果集。它会去除重复的行,并将结果集合并成一个
原创 2024-07-14 06:44:57
244阅读
# MySQL UNION ALL 分页解析 在数据库管理中,分页是一个常见的需求。尤其是在处理大型数据集时,如何高效地进行分页显得尤为重要。本文将探讨如何使用 MySQL 的 `UNION ALL` 语句进行分页,配合实际代码示例,帮助大家更好地理解这一过程。 ## 什么是 UNION ALL? `UNION ALL` 是 SQL 中用于将两个或多个结果集合并的运算符。与 `UNION`
原创 2024-08-31 09:28:06
93阅读
# MySQL union分页实现步骤 ## 1. 理解 MySQL union 查询和分页原理 在开始实现 MySQL union分页之前,首先需要理解 MySQL union 查询和分页的原理。 - MySQL union 查询:`union` 操作符用于合并两个或多个 `SELECT` 语句的结果集,并消除重复的行。 - MySQL 分页分页是指将查询结果分割成多页显示,每页
原创 2023-10-17 04:58:53
838阅读
# 使用MySQL UNION连接多个查询结果 ## 1. 概述 MySQLUNION操作可以将多个查询结果合并成一个结果集。它将多个SELECT语句的结果合并在一起并去除重复的行。这在某些情况下非常有用,比如需要在一个查询中返回多个相关联的表的结果。 本文将介绍如何使用MySQLUNION操作连接多个查询结果,并提供实际的代码示例。 ## 2. 流程 下表是使用MySQL UNION
原创 2023-08-22 03:39:02
229阅读
 1.mysql   union  语法mysql   union 用于把来自多个select  语句的结果组合到一个结果集合中。语法为:select  column,......from table1union [all]select  column,...... from table2...在多个select  语
转载 2024-06-19 23:32:12
34阅读
.MySQL分页 一:分页需求: 客户端通过传递start(页码),limit(每页显示的条数)两个参数去分页查询数据库表中的数据,那我们知道MySql数据库提供了分页的函数limit m,n,但是该函数的用法和我们的需求不一样,所以就需要我们根据实际情况去改写适合我们自己的分页语句,具体的分析如下: 比如: 查询第1条到第10条的数据的sql是:select * from table
MySQL中的分页操作一、 背景什么是分页,就是查询时候数据量太大,一次性返回所有查询结果既耗费网络资源、又降低了查询效率,用户也不可能一下子看完成千上万条数据。所以分页的技术就应运而生。分页可以只显示指定数量的数据。分页在我们的生活中随处可见,如下图所示的电商网站:二、 实现规则2.1 关键字 LIMIT 在MySQL中,使用关键字 LIMIT 实现分页操作。格式为:LIMIT 位置偏移量, 每
转载 2023-07-22 15:09:19
301阅读
SQL Server关于分页 SQL 的资料许多,有的使用存储过程,有的使用游标。本人不喜欢使用游标,我觉得它耗资、效率低;使用存储过程是个不错的选择,因为存储过程是颠末预编译的,执行效率高,也更灵活。先看看单条 SQL 语句的分页 SQL 吧。方法1:适用于 SQL Server 2000/2005SELECT TOP 页大小 * FROM table1 WHERE id NOT IN ( SE
MySQL一直是面试中的热点问题,也难道了很多的面试者。其实MySQL没那么难,只是大家没有系统化、实战性的过去学习、总结。同时很多开发者在实际的开发过程中也很少去接触一些偏向底层的知识。今天这篇文章,将为大家总结MySQL中场景的面试题。围绕索引、事务、锁等几个方面的热点问题,系统化的总结。涉及到文章篇幅,可以通过该文阅读全文内容。大致分为如下大纲:什么是索引?请简述常用的索引有哪些种类?索引是
# MySQL 使用 UNION 进行分页结果 在实际开发中,分页查询是一个非常常见的需求。在 MySQL 中,我们通常使用 `LIMIT` 关键字来控制查询结果的返回条数和起始位置。然而,当我们需要合并来自多个表的数据时,单纯的使用 `LIMIT` 可能会变得复杂。在这种情况下,使用 `UNION` 操作符结合分页技术是一个有效的解决方案。 ## `UNION` 的基本概念 `UNION`
原创 10月前
201阅读
# MySQL Union的结果分页:新手开发者指南 当你在使用MySQL进行数据查询的时候,经常会遇到需要将多个查询结果合并并进行分页的情况。本文将带你一步一步了解如何使用`UNION`来合并不同表的数据,并对其进行分页操作。 ## 流程概述 在进行“MySQL UNION的结果分页”操作时,通常可以遵循以下几个步骤: | 步骤 | 描述
原创 2024-09-17 04:08:03
366阅读
## 实现“mysql union all 分页 排序”的步骤 ### 1. 创建两个表 首先,我们需要创建两个数据库表,用于演示union all分页排序的操作。我们假设这两个表分别是`table1`和`table2`,每个表都包含`id`和`name`两个字段。 我们可以使用以下的SQL语句创建这两个表: ```sql CREATE TABLE table1 ( id INT PR
原创 2023-09-27 23:36:58
433阅读
  • 1
  • 2
  • 3
  • 4
  • 5